高性能多協(xié)議目標(biāo)器的設(shè)計(jì)與實(shí)現(xiàn)
本文選題:網(wǎng)絡(luò)存儲(chǔ) + 磁盤陣列 ; 參考:《華中科技大學(xué)》2012年碩士論文
【摘要】:面對(duì)網(wǎng)絡(luò)云時(shí)代數(shù)據(jù)爆炸式的增長,企業(yè)對(duì)存儲(chǔ)產(chǎn)品的容量與傳輸速率的要求與日俱增。磁盤陣列是構(gòu)建存儲(chǔ)系統(tǒng)的關(guān)鍵基礎(chǔ)設(shè)備,而SCSI(SmallComputerSystemInterface)目標(biāo)器作為陣列控制器中關(guān)鍵組成部分之一,它直接決定了磁盤陣列與服務(wù)器間傳輸速率的上限,目標(biāo)器的設(shè)計(jì)應(yīng)緊跟相關(guān)硬件的發(fā)展。FC(FibreChannel)協(xié)議和iSCSI(internetSCSI)協(xié)議作為目標(biāo)器首選的主流協(xié)議,應(yīng)優(yōu)先予以支持。 分析Linux通用目標(biāo)器子系統(tǒng)的功能及其內(nèi)部體系結(jié)構(gòu),研究實(shí)現(xiàn)多協(xié)議目標(biāo)器的方案,分別闡述目標(biāo)器對(duì)輸入/輸出請(qǐng)求的處理流程。以一個(gè)正在進(jìn)行的磁盤陣列控制器項(xiàng)目為基礎(chǔ),基于Linux通用目標(biāo)器子系統(tǒng),在磁盤陣列系統(tǒng)上構(gòu)建通用的多協(xié)議目標(biāo)器結(jié)構(gòu),同時(shí)支持FC協(xié)議與iSCSI協(xié)議。最后,,采用測試工具對(duì)多協(xié)議目標(biāo)器模塊進(jìn)行性能評(píng)測。測試結(jié)果表明,F(xiàn)C目標(biāo)器的性能優(yōu)越,最高數(shù)據(jù)傳輸率可達(dá)450MByte/s;iSCSI目標(biāo)器運(yùn)行穩(wěn)定,且最高能達(dá)到90%以上網(wǎng)絡(luò)利用率。
[Abstract]:Faced with the explosive growth of data in the era of network cloud, the demand for storage capacity and transmission rate is increasing day by day. Disk array is the key equipment for building storage system. As one of the key components of array controller, SCSIN SmallComputer system Interface (SCSI) directly determines the upper limit of transmission rate between disk array and server. The design of the target device should follow the development of the related hardware. FCU FibreChannelProtocol and iSCSIN internetSCSIprotocol should be the preferred mainstream protocols for the target device and should be supported first. This paper analyzes the function of Linux general target subsystem and its internal architecture, studies the scheme of implementing multi-protocol target, and expounds the processing flow of input / output request. Based on an ongoing disk array controller project, a general multi-protocol target structure is constructed on disk array system based on Linux universal target subsystem, and FC protocol and iSCSI protocol are supported at the same time. Finally, the performance of multi-protocol target module is evaluated by testing tools. The test results show that the performance of the FC target is superior, the maximum data transmission rate can reach 450 MByte / s / s SCSI target, and the maximum can reach 90% network utilization rate.
【學(xué)位授予單位】:華中科技大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2012
【分類號(hào)】:TP333
【參考文獻(xiàn)】
相關(guān)期刊論文 前10條
1 王楊,朱朝霞;網(wǎng)絡(luò)環(huán)境下的數(shù)據(jù)存儲(chǔ)技術(shù)[J];重慶工學(xué)院學(xué)報(bào);2004年04期
2 楊勇;;FC SAN與IP SAN全面比較[J];廣播與電視技術(shù);2007年12期
3 謝長生,李書成;SAN互聯(lián)新技術(shù)——InfiniBand[J];計(jì)算機(jī)工程;2003年20期
4 趙德平;史桂穎;;基于Linux網(wǎng)絡(luò)塊設(shè)備和軟RAID技術(shù)的網(wǎng)絡(luò)鏡像[J];計(jì)算機(jī)工程;2007年18期
5 田磊,馮丹;存儲(chǔ)區(qū)域網(wǎng)中磁盤陣列光纖通道接口的設(shè)計(jì)與實(shí)現(xiàn)[J];計(jì)算機(jī)工程與科學(xué);2005年07期
6 劉敏,王意潔;并行I/O技術(shù)研究[J];計(jì)算機(jī)應(yīng)用研究;2003年08期
7 劉志強(qiáng);王麗芳;蔣澤軍;劉衛(wèi)東;;一種SCSI目標(biāo)器設(shè)計(jì)與評(píng)估[J];計(jì)算機(jī)測量與控制;2010年01期
8 冰原;;InfiniBand統(tǒng)一數(shù)據(jù)中心[J];每周電腦報(bào);2006年26期
9 潘家銘;舒繼武;張素琴;鄭緯民;;Design and Implementation of SCSI Target Emulator[J];Tsinghua Science and Technology;2006年01期
10 李必剛;舒繼武;鄭緯民;;SCSI Target Simulator Based on FC and IP Protocols in TH-MSNS[J];Tsinghua Science and Technology;2006年05期
相關(guān)碩士學(xué)位論文 前2條
1 趙鳳;基于光纖通道的SCSI目標(biāo)器的設(shè)計(jì)與實(shí)現(xiàn)[D];電子科技大學(xué);2011年
2 石磊;磁盤陣列控制器中iSCSI目標(biāo)器的設(shè)計(jì)與實(shí)現(xiàn)[D];華中科技大學(xué);2007年
本文編號(hào):2033329
本文鏈接:http://www.sikaile.net/kejilunwen/jisuanjikexuelunwen/2033329.html